Let’s look at the main dialogue. |
Two people are having a conversation. |
따뜻한 아메리카노 한 잔 주세요. 얼마나 걸려요? |
Ttatteuthan americano han jan juseyo. Eolmana geollyeoyo? |
One hot Americano, please. How long will it take? |
네, 알겠습니다. 15분 정도 기다리셔야 해요. |
Ne, algetseumnida. Sibobun jeongdo gidarisyeoya haeyo. |
Alright. You'll have to wait about 15 minutes. |
Here, because the verb stem 기다리시 (gidarisi) ends in the vowel ㅣ (i), we use the ending -어야. When combined with the honorific marker 시, this becomes 셔야. |
